What's proper care after a tongue or lip tie release?
Proper aftercare following tongue and lip tie release procedures is crucial for a successful recovery. It helps promote healing, reduce discomfort, and prevent complications.
- After the procedure, it's important to follow the dentist's instructions diligently. This may include gentle stretches or exercises to prevent reattachment of the ties.
- Good oral hygiene is essential during the healing process. Gently cleaning around the wound site can help prevent infection and promote faster healing.
- It's normal for babies or children to experience some discomfort after the procedure. Providing pain relief, as the dentist recommends, can help keep them comfortable during this time.
- Regular follow-up appointments with our dentists are necessary to monitor progress and address any concerns arising during the healing process.
By prioritizing proper aftercare, you can support your child's recovery and ensure optimal outcomes following tongue and lip tie release procedures.
